Description
Rodney Marsh's autobiography offers a captivating glimpse into the life of one of football's most colorful characters. From his early days on the pitch to his triumphant journey across the Atlantic, readers are treated to an array of personal anecdotes that highlight both his successes and challenges. His unique perspective on the game, infused with humor and honesty, brings the vibrant world of football to life.
Throughout the narrative, Marsh reflects on pivotal moments in his career, unveiling the behind-the-scenes antics and unforgettable encounters that shaped his legacy in the sport. His anecdotes paint a vivid picture of the highs and lows experienced on and off the field, revealing the enduring impact of the game on his life.
With a writing style that resonates with fans and newcomers alike, Marsh's autobiography serves as a testament to his passion for football and the relationships he forged along the way. This compelling story is not only about a player's journey but also about the evolution of the sport itself and its ability to unite people across borders.
